Beyond risk perception: the critical and conditional role of perceptual bias in air pollution defensive behaviors

Individuals frequently adopt self-defensive behaviors to mitigate the threat of air pollution, playing a crucial complementary role to governmental pollution control. Understanding the mechanisms and determinants of these behaviors is therefore key for effective policy-making. While prior research has established a link between risk perception and behavior, it has largely overlooked themagnitude, direction, and impact of perceptual bias. This study addresses this gap by examining the discrepancy between subjective air pollution assessments and objective pollution levels. We focus specifically on how perceptual biases—operationalized as overestimation or underestimation—influence self-defensive behaviors. Our findings reveal that income, education, pollution exposure, and access to information are significant moderators of these biases. By conceptualizing perceptual bias as a critical and moderated construct, this study advances theories of pro-environmental behavior. We propose targeted interventions, such as improving the accessibility and clarity of environmental information, enhancing public knowledge, and designing interventions tailored to regions with varying pollution levels. These findings contribute to a deeper integration of perceptual biases into pro-environmental behavior theories and offer practical recommendations for promoting appropriate self-defensive behaviors.
